Human Research Protection Programs and Institutional Review Boards are often discussed together, but they are not the same—and understanding the difference matters for everyone involved in clinical research. Adam McClintock, Executive Director of HRPP at the University of Alabama at Birmingham, brings more than 20 years of industry experience to a clear conversation about how HRPPs support ethical, participant-centered research beyond the formal work of IRBs. He also explains why the industry needs better ways to measure whether HRPPs are truly effective.

Christine Melton-Lopez adds the participant perspective, sharing candid stories from multiple research studies and how those experiences shaped her career in the research industry. Her reflections offer practical questions for anyone considering study participation and a hopeful reminder of why improving research matters.
